Indian Navy will continue to ensure maritime security of nation: Prez
Millennium Post Kolkata|December 05, 2024
PRESIDENT MURMU SAYS WHILE GRACING THE NAVY DAY CELEBRATION

PURI: Invoking the blessings of the 'God of the Ocean' (Varuna) for all-round development of the country, President Droupadi Murmu on Wednesday said she was confident that the Indian Navy will continue to ensure maritime security of the country.

Murmu, the supreme commander of the country's defence forces, said this while gracing the Navy Day celebration at the Blu Flag Beach in Odisha's Puri.

"I am confident that the Indian Navy will continue to ensure maritime security, essential for Viksit Bharat by 2047," the President said.

Murmu said with 63 ships being built in India, the Navy's focus to be an 'Atmanirbhar' force by 2047 provides inspiration to all of us to pursue innovation in 'Mission Mode'.
